What Is the PMT Score in BISP – And Why It Matters?

The PMT Score (Proxy Means Test Score) is a key eligibility indicator used by the Benazir Income Support Programme (BISP) to assess a household’s poverty level. This score is calculated based on data collected through the NSER (National Socio-Economic Registry) Dynamic Survey, which includes eligible person details such as their income, their family size, their education level, their assets, and their living conditions.

The purpose of the PMT score is simple: to identify the most financially vulnerable families across Pakistan and ensure they receive targeted financial assistance under BISP.

Key Facts About PMT Score:

  • Score Range: 0 to 100.
  • Interpretation: If the family has a lower score, they are very poor. They deserve support. 
  • Eligibility Threshold: Any Family has less than 32 PMT score they will be considered eligible for BISP Kafaalat cash assistance.

If a woman whose household has a PMT score of 25 is likely to be approved for quarterly payments, while someone with a score above 40 may be ineligible due to relatively better financial conditions.

How to Check Your PMT Score and BISP Status in 2025

Method 1: Via SMS – Fast & Simple

  1. Open your phone’s SMS app
  2. Type your 13-digit CNIC number
  3. Send it to 8171
  4. You’ll receive a message with your:
    • PMT Score
    • BISP eligibility status
    • Payment update (if applicable)

Method 2: Through the 8171 Web Portal

  1. Go to https://8171.pass.gov.pk
  2. Enter your CNIC number
  3. Complete the captcha verification
  4. Click Submit
  5. Instantly view your:
    • PMT Score
    • BISP eligibility results
    • Latest payment release status

Who Qualifies for BISP Payments in 2025?

The Benazir Kafaalat Program in 2025 is specifically designed to support low-income women across Pakistan, especially those who are widowed, divorced, or managing their households without male support. To ensure that only the truly deserving receive financial aid, the government has set clear eligibility criteria based on updated socio-economic data.

To qualify for BISP Kafaalat payments in 2025, an applicant must:

  • Be a female head of household, this includes women who are widowed, divorced, married but managing the household finances, or separated.
  • Possess a valid and active CNIC issued by NADRA. Without a CNIC, the application will be considered incomplete.
  • Belong to a low-income family, assessed through the NSER Dynamic Survey and measured using a PMT score (Proxy Means Test).
  • Have a PMT score below 32, indicating financial vulnerability and lack of stable income.
  • Not be a government employee or a pension recipient from any federal or provincial department.
  • Be registered and verified through the 8171 Dynamic Survey, which is the official method of enrollment and updating eligibility data.
  • Reside in Pakistan, whether in urban or rural areas, and must be a permanent citizen of the country.

Women who meet these conditions are eligible to receive quarterly cash assistance of Rs. 13,500, which may be adjusted according to future inflation rates or budget announcements. Latest BISP Payment Amount for 2025

As per the new update, eligible women will receive Rs. 13,500 every quarter. Payment amounts may be adjusted in response to inflation or updated government policy.

Payment Collection Channels:

  • BISP Tehsil Offices
  • HBL Konnect Retailers
  • JazzCash / Easypaisa (in pilot areas)
  • Bank Transfers (linked to CNIC)

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) – BISP 8171 New Update

Q1: What is a good PMT score for BISP approval in 2025?

A PMT score under 32 is generally required to qualify for the BISP Kafaalat program.

Q2: I didn’t get any message after sending my CNIC to 8171. What should I do?

Check if your SIM is registered under your CNIC and try again. Or visit the 8171 web portal for instant results.

Q3: Can men apply for BISP under this program?

BISP Kafaalat is primarily for female heads of households, though men may benefit under other BISP initiatives.

Q4: Is this service available 24/7?

Yes, both the SMS service and the web portal are available anytime, day or night.

Q5: What if my PMT score is above the cutoff?

You may not qualify for BISP, but you can still apply for other support schemes such as Ehsaas Rashan, Nashonuma, or Interest-Free Loans.
